Transaction 178a353c03b63055ca02499e3668645ee3a655fa173cd9aedd55b226c5e66ff3
1 Input
1 Output
-
178a353c03b63055ca02499e3668645ee3a655fa173cd9aedd55b226c5e66ff3:0
- value
- 184858
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bbc1ddc4b436c1324e6b363da1412a94260bc99
- address
- bc1q3w7pmhztgdkpxf8xkd3a59qj49pxp0ye0tz4jv